2010/1/8 mateusgra <mateus...@bol.com.br>: > > Os dois ja leram: > http://it.toolbox.com/blogs/database-soup/testing-for-normalization-33119
Sim, mas obrigado por lembrar… excelente, e CQD! ;-) > http://it.toolbox.com/blogs/database-soup/normalization-performance-and-virtual-private-databases-32525 Também excelente, e também CQD. Surpreendentemente, um dos melhores comentários (sobre NULLs) é do Celko. Eu faço uma coisa um pouco diferente dos dois: olho amostras aleatórias dos dados, depois de analisar as chaves e os nomes dos objetos. Analiso primeiro as tabelas com alta proporção de NULLs. Embora o teste do Celko seja válido, de verificar que atributos /aceitam/ NULL, freqüentemente todos os atributos que não sejam parte da chave primária aceitam NULL e, numa emergência como sói acontecer, vale a pena achar as relações mais mal normalizadas através da ocorrência de NULLs na relação em si, não apenas na relvar. Muitos NULLs costumam indicar a mistura de n entidades numa única relação. > De Josh Berkus (CEO, PostgreSQL Experts) . Graaande Berkus. Quero virar amigo e empregado dele… ;-) Aproveitando a deixa, tenho vontade (mas não pachorra) de criar a filial brasileira da SSKA <http://www.pgexperts.com/document.html?id=24>. Desculpai-me se pareço recorrer ao argumento (falacioso) da autoridade, mas realmente concordo quase integralmente com o Berkus, realmente ele é uma das coisas mais próximas que temos a uma autoridade em assuntos conceituais na comunidade PostgreSQL… e estou cansado de debater. -- skype:leandro.gfc.dutra?chat Yahoo!: ymsgr:sendIM?lgcdutra +55 (11) 3854 7191 gTalk: xmpp:leand...@jabber.org +55 (11) 9406 7191 ICQ/AIM: aim:GoIM?screenname=61287803 BRAZIL GMT-3 MSN: msnim:chat?contact=lean...@dutra.fastmail.fm Sent from Sao Paulo, SP, Brésil _______________________________________________ pgbr-geral mailing list pgbr-geral@listas.postgresql.org.br https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ral